= Question 4 Water flows vertically and at a constant rate in a pipe of length L, as shown in Figure 4. The pipe consists of a circular outer pipe of radius R and a central rod of radius R/4. The walls of the outer pipe are coated with Teflon so that the water does not wet the surface (negligible shear). The inner rod is not coated, so that the water does wet the surface. The walls are non-porous. The inlet and outlet of the pipe are exposed to atmosphere, such that the inlet and outlet static pressures are the same. Assuming that L/R >> 10 and that the flow is laminar and axisymmetric, determine the following. ! P = P 28 2R P out =P Teflon coated cylinder uncoated rod g Figure 4: Schematic of vertical pipe with central rod. (a) A formula for the radial distribution of the radial velocity component v. (b) A formula for the radial distribution of the vertical velocity component Uz.
